The Role of Nonverbal Communication

Much of our communication is nonverbal, and our body language speaks volumes before we even utter a word. Maintaining strong eye contact, adopting an open and relaxed posture, and using confident gestures can significantly enhance your presence. Practicing mindful awareness of your own nonverbal cues, and learning to read the nonverbal signals of others, is a powerful tool for building rapport and establishing trust. Consider how you physically present yourself – clothing, grooming, and overall appearance can all contribute to the impression you make. These aren't superficial concerns; they reflect your self-respect and signal to others how you value yourself. The goal isn’t to be someone you’re not, but to embody your authentic self with confidence and grace.

Successful communication isn’t just about what you say, but how you say it. Variations in tone, pace, and volume can convey a wide range of emotions and intentions. Speaking clearly and deliberately, avoiding filler words like “um” and “ah,” and pausing strategically can enhance your credibility and authority. Active listening is equally important. Demonstrating genuine interest in what others have to say, asking clarifying questions, and providing thoughtful responses fosters connection and builds trust. Developing these communication skills isn’t merely about professional advancement; it’s about building stronger, more meaningful relationships in all areas of your life.

Cultivating Inner Resilience and Self-Belief

Resilience, the ability to bounce back from setbacks, is a cornerstone of a win aura. Life inevitably throws challenges our way, and how we respond to those challenges defines us. Building resilience involves developing a growth mindset – the belief that our abilities and intelligence can be developed through dedication and hard work. It also means learning to reframe negative experiences as opportunities for growth and learning, rather than dwelling on failures. Practicing self-compassion, treating yourself with the same kindness and understanding you would offer a friend, is crucial for navigating difficult times. Resilience isn't about avoiding pain; it's about processing it in a healthy way and emerging stronger on the other side.

The Power of Positive Self-Talk

Our internal dialogue plays a significant role in shaping our beliefs and behaviors. Negative self-talk can undermine our confidence and sabotage our efforts. Becoming aware of your inner critic and challenging its limiting beliefs is a vital step in cultivating a more positive and empowering mindset. Replace negative thoughts with affirmations – positive statements that reinforce your strengths and capabilities. Focus on your achievements, no matter how small, and celebrate your progress. Practice gratitude, acknowledging the good things in your life, to shift your focus from what's lacking to what you already have. The goal isn’t to eliminate negative thoughts altogether, but to manage them effectively and prevent them from controlling your actions.

  • Identify your limiting beliefs: What negative thoughts hold you back?
  • Challenge those beliefs: Are they based on facts or assumptions?
  • Replace them with affirmations: Positive statements about your capabilities.
  • Practice gratitude: Focus on the good things in your life.
  • Celebrate your achievements: Acknowledge your progress, no matter how small.

Building strong self-belief is a continuous journey, and requires consistent effort and self-awareness. It’s not about denying challenges, but about facing them with courage and optimism, knowing that you have the inner resources to overcome them.

Handling Criticism and Setbacks

Criticism is an inevitable part of life, and learning to handle it constructively is essential for maintaining your confidence. Don't take criticism personally, but rather view it as an opportunity for growth. Listen actively to the feedback, asking clarifying questions to ensure you understand the concerns. Separate constructive criticism from personal attacks, and dismiss any comments that are intended to belittle or demean you. Remember that not all criticism is valid, and you have the right to disagree. Setbacks are also inevitable, and it’s important to learn from your mistakes without dwelling on them. Analyze what went wrong, identify areas for improvement, and move forward with renewed determination.

  1. Receive feedback with an open mind.
  2. Ask clarifying questions to understand the criticism.
  3. Separate constructive criticism from personal attacks.
  4. Learn from your mistakes without dwelling on them.
  5. Focus on solutions and move forward.

Resilience is built through these experiences, and the ability to navigate criticism and setbacks with grace is a hallmark of a truly confident individual.
